Problem 1: Write two equivalent ratios for \( \frac{5}{9} \)

Step 1: Multiply numerator and denominator by 2

To find an equivalent ratio, we can multiply both the numerator and the denominator of the ratio \( \frac{5}{9} \) by the same non - zero number. Let's multiply by 2.
\( \frac{5\times2}{9\times2}=\frac{10}{18} \)

Step 2: Multiply numerator and denominator by 3

Now, multiply the numerator and denominator of \( \frac{5}{9} \) by 3.
\( \frac{5\times3}{9\times3}=\frac{15}{27} \)
